A daemon that accepts requests from MCP clients to start dev servers, allocating unique ports to avoid collisions and shutting down idle connections after 120s of inactivity.
- User starts daemon
- User's first MCP client (eg coding CLI) requests to run a dev server
- Dev server is started on PORT 3010
- User's second MCP client (eg coding CLI) requests to run a dev server
- Dev server is started on PORT 3011
- Run multiple dev servers in parallel: useful if you want to use automated testing tools eg Playwright or Google Dev Tools MCP
- Avoid port collisions: when working with websites, it's often necessary to specify different ports if you want to run multiple dev servers
- Automatic port allocation starting at 3010 with reuse
- Log capture with 512KB ring buffers per server
- Auto-cleanup of idle sessions after 120 seconds (configurable via
--idle-timeout)
Requirements: Node.js >= 18
The recommended way to use dev-manager-mcp is via npx:
Make sure the daemon is running in a terminal somewhere:
npx -y dev-manager-mcpAdd this MCP config to your coding CLI:
{
"mcpServers": {
"dev-manager": {
"command": "npx",
"args": ["dev-manager-mcp", "stdio"]
}
}
}Finally, ask your coding CLI to start a dev server. You should see it use the MCP server.

}- port_allocator.rs - Sequential port allocation from 3010 with free list
- log_buffer.rs - Bounded 512KB ring buffer with Clone support
- server_entry.rs - Process wrapper with async log capture
- manager.rs - Shared state manager with auto-cleanup sweeper
- service.rs - MCP service with tool definitions
- main.rs - HTTP/SSE daemon server
- Single
Arc<Manager>shared across all client connections - Each connection gets a fresh
DevManagerServiceinstance - Mutex-protected HashMap for session storage
- Background sweeper runs every 5 seconds to clean up idle sessions (>120s by default)
- Auto-generated 4-character uppercase alphanumeric codes (e.g., "A3X9", "K7M2")
- Guaranteed unique across active sessions
- 1,679,616 possible combinations (36^4)
- Starts at 3010 and increments sequentially
- Maintains free list for reused ports
- Probes availability with TcpListener before assignment
- Each server spawns two async tasks for stdout/stderr
- Logs stored in bounded VecDeque with byte tracking
- Oldest entries evicted when 512KB limit reached
- Non-blocking reads with line buffering

If you prefer to build from source or need offline/advanced usage:
cargo build --releaseThe binary will be at target/release/dev-manager-mcp.
To use the built binary, replace npx dev-manager-mcp with ./target/release/dev-manager-mcp in all examples above.
